The Vespa 946 EMPORIO ARMANI was a Four stroke, single cylinder, catalytic converter, EFI, SOHC, 3 valves scooter produced by Vespa in 2016.

Drive[edit | edit source]

The bike has a CVT, twist and go transmission. Power was moderated via the Automatic, dry centrifuge with vibration dampets.

Chassis[edit | edit source]

It came with a 120/70-12" front tire and a 130/70-12" rear tire. Stopping was achieved via Single disc 220 mm in the front and a Single disc 220 mm in the rear. The front suspension was a Single link arm with coil spring and dual-action hydraulic shock absorber while the rear was equipped with a Coil spring with adjustable preload, mono shock with progressive lever system. The wheelbase was 55.31 inches (1405 mm) long.

Piaggio have collaborated with fashion icon Giorgio Armani and the two have jointly developed the new Vespa 946 Emporio Armani, which marks the 40th anniversary of the foundation of Giorgio Armani as well as the 130th birthday of the Piaggio Group. In keeping with Armani’s signature subtle color palette, the Vespa 946 Emporio Armani features a beautiful combination of grays with subtle hints of dark olive green that's only visible under certain light conditions. Metallic parts also get a matt finish that's in keeping with the body finish. The words ‘Emporio Armani’ appear on the side, while the iconic Eagle logo of the brand sits above the headlight. Brown leather seat and matching luggage complete the package.
